## Archiving Cold Storage Buckets

Buckets idle for 180 days move to the Glacierline archive tier automatically. Release managers must confirm no pending rollback artifacts exist in a bucket before sign-off; the archiver will not check. Archive state lives in the lifecycle table. To verify bucket status before a release, connect with the string below.

primary connection of yagep-kahip = redis://giliel_svc:zYiKsLL2PLpfPL@db-348f.xolmarsys.corp:5432/fenwyn

Contrast audit on the Fennick dashboard flagged these components. Don't eyeball ratios — new folks, always use the audit script in tools/a11y. Secondary buttons and muted captions fail at small sizes. Fix tokens, not individual components. Thresholds below come straight from our internal Brightmark guidelines and should not be loosened without a design sign-off. Current minimums:

constants for tageg-kagag:
QUOTAS = {
    "kelax": 495,
    "istath": 366,
    "tammir": 108,
    "novdor": 730,
    "casax": 816,
    "quenael": 874,
    "pelius": 403,
}

Subject: Export retry cut-over done

Retrybox is live as of 03:10. Failed exports from the Corvane pipeline now requeue automatically with backoff; the old manual drain script is retired. Backlog of 1,842 stuck jobs cleared in 40 minutes. Page only if the dead-letter queue grows. Active values below.

config for hahip-kaguf:
[holath]
port = 8443
region = north-4
host = holath.tolvaqlabs.internal
timeout_ms = 1000
retries = 2